#472779 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#472779 is composed of 27.8% red, 15.3%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.3% cyan, 67.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 263.4 degrees, a saturation of 51.3% and a lightness of 31.4%. #472779 color hex could be obtained by blending #8e4ef2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#472779 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#472779 has RGB values of R:71, G:39,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 4663161.
